Read MoreThe boys varsity cross country team finished first out of seven teams at the Pre-Regional hosted by Corunna today. The Redwings turned in five times under 17:00 minutes and turned in six of the top 11 finishes. Ryan Brown led the way finishing first overall with a time of 16:20.35. Other top 11 finishes included…

Read MoreThe Redwings had an amazing day at the CAAC Red League Meet at Haslett! The Varsity boys won their race, Ryan Brown finished first, Griffin Armbrustmacher finished second and the Redwings had five finishers in the top ten.
